  • Description

    I grew up on a farm so I feel happiest when I'm in a natural environment - forest, garden, park, mountain, river, sea....

    I like volunteering opportunities to help maintain & conserve habitats - from tree planting to wetland restoration, citizen science data collection to plant propagation.

    I started travelling in my teens visiting my older sister living in the mountainous region of Alto Adige, north of Bolzano. We made several trips south looking for historical remains of the Phoenicians, ending up in Sicily. Later, I helped her restore an old olive press in Tuscany & worked in the olive grove.

    I also spent a summer on Fetlar, Shetland Islands, volunteering for an ornithological survey of the Storm Petrels & Fulmars.

    Immediately after completing my degree I took a job in Damascus, Syria. I'm so pleased I saw the country in the 70s when it was possible to visit Krak des Chevalier, Palmyra & Aleppo.

    I started teaching English as a Foreign Language in Barcelona & nipped up the Pyrenees most weekends to hike in the mountains.

    One thing lead to another & I ended up working, marrying & living in Brazil - starting in Rio de Janeiro, then Sao Paulo &, finally, Vila Velha in Espirito Santo, near Bahia. The Mata Atlantica (Atlantic Rainforest) is my favourite biome. We kept an old fisherman's shack for our holidays on Ilha Grande, off the coast between Rio & Sao Paulo. It was bliss - no cars, no roads, no electricity & the most beautiful forest & seascape. The only access, where we stayed, was by taking lifts with locals crossing over in their boats & as there was no quay in 'our' bay we had to hop into the sea where the surf started & swim to shore.

    Returning to the UK in the early 2000s I joined an international company & travelled extensively.

    Now I am retired I have more time to volunteer & travel. I'm hoping joining WorkAway will help me find new friends & new opportunities.
